#444854 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#444854 is composed of 26.7% red, 28.2%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19% cyan, 14.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 67.1% black. It has a hue angle of 225 degrees, a saturation of 10.5% and a lightness of 29.8%. #444854 color hex could be obtained by blending #8890a8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#444854 color description : Very dark grayish blue.
#444854 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#444854 has RGB values of R:68, G:72,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0.14, Y:0,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 4474964.

Shades and Tints of #444854
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070708 is the darkest color, while #fcfcfd is the lightest one.
